About Lufkin H S

Lufkin H S is a public high school in Lufkin, TX, part of LUFKIN ISD. Lufkin H S serves approximately 2,101 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 12:1 student-teacher ratio. Lufkin H S has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.5 out of 10 and ranks #4,103 of 8,552 schools in TX.

Structured state assessment records for Lufkin H S show 65%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 62%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

What Parents Should Know

Lufkin H S is a large school: 2,101 students. Size usually brings more course choices and activities than a smaller school can staff, but kids can also blend into the crowd. Ask how the school keeps students known and supported.
